About Blackburn 3130

The size of Blackburn is approximately 5.9 square kilometres. It has 23 parks covering nearly 12% of total area. The population of Blackburn in 2011 was 12,795 people. By 2016 the population was 13,927 showing a population growth of 8.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Blackburn is 40-49 years. Households in Blackburn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Blackburn work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 76.7% of the homes in Blackburn were owner-occupied compared with 72.3% in 2016.
